U. Löw has authored 41 papers that have received a total of 1.2k indexed citations.
This includes 34 papers in Condensed Matter Physics, 16 papers in Atomic and Molecular Physics, and Optics and 15 papers in Electronic, Optical and Magnetic Materials. The topics of these papers are Physics of Superconductivity and Magnetism (25 papers), Advanced Condensed Matter Physics (17 papers) and Theoretical and Computational Physics (14 papers). U. Löw is often cited by papers focused on Physics of Superconductivity and Magnetism (25 papers), Advanced Condensed Matter Physics (17 papers) and Theoretical and Computational Physics (14 papers) and collaborates with scholars based in Germany, United States and France. U. Löw's co-authors include B. Lüthi, K. Fabricius, S. Zherlitsyn, K.-H. Mütter and B. Wolf and has published in prestigious journals such as Physical Review Letters, Physical Review B and Physics Letters B.
